Output 8d13ac729e4208cc4db233a199bb9690d51a3a38eaf12e6ac773837f7647706b:23

value
755680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cf477975d53f14242a2ae0b2ccf9800e52dfeaa OP_EQUAL
address
3Jv7pUzeyEk4gkyCWNCEW3L6ukKPdzAzCP
transaction
8d13ac729e4208cc4db233a199bb9690d51a3a38eaf12e6ac773837f7647706b
spent
true